It’s a general misconception among many individuals that
skills section could be avoided. Some of them believe that this section is a
mere listing of skills. They feel presenting a list of educational
qualifications would work wonders and impress the recruiters. We tend to forget
the importance of skills section in the resume.
The skills sections play a very effective role in
the resume. It informs the recruiter about some of your important
characteristics or even personality traits suitable for the post. This section
should be placed after the contact details and objective section in the resume.
